Google plans to reactivate nuclear power plant for AI infrastructure

IOWA / LONDON (IT BOLTWISE) – Google plans to restart a decommissioned nuclear power plant in Iowa to meet the increasing energy needs of its AI and cloud infrastructure. This strategic decision underscores the increasing pressure on tech companies to use sustainable energy sources to manage the growing power consumption of their data centers.

US technology giant Google has announced that it will restart a decommissioned nuclear power plant in the state of Iowa to meet the increasing energy needs of its artificial intelligence (AI) and cloud infrastructure. This decision comes at a time when power consumption in data centers worldwide is increasing rapidly. According to the International Energy Agency, the energy demand of these centers is expected to more than double by 2030.

The Duane Arnold Energy Center, which was taken offline in 2020, is scheduled to restart in 2029. Google has reached an agreement with energy company NextEra Energy that will purchase electricity over a period of 25 years. This partnership is described as a strategic collaboration designed to enable Google to responsibly expand its business needs. Nuclear energy is highlighted as a CO2-free energy source.

Google’s decision to rely on nuclear energy is part of a larger trend in the tech industry. Other large companies such as Microsoft and Meta have also taken similar steps. Microsoft plans to restart a reactor at the decommissioned Three Mile Island nuclear power plant to power its data centers. Meta has secured the entire energy production of a nuclear power plant in Illinois for 20 years.

These developments raise questions about the sustainability and security of energy supplies. While nuclear energy is considered a zero-emissions alternative, the risks and disposal of nuclear waste remain controversial. Nevertheless, the tech industry seems willing to accept these challenges in order to meet the growing energy needs of its infrastructures. The future will show whether this strategy is sustainable in the long term and what impact it will have on the environment and society.
